Transition Metal Carbyne Complexes, XXXVI. Nucleophilic Substitution on trans-Tetracarbonyl(organylcarbyne)(tetrafluoroborato) Complexes of Chromium and Tungsten with Triphenylphosphine, Cyanide and ThiocyanatePentacarbonyl[methoxy(phenyl)carbene]- and -[methoxy(methyl)carbene]tungsten(0) (1a, b) react in boron trifluoride dimethyletherate in the presence of a large excess of BF3 to form trans- (BF4)(CO)4WCR complexes (2a, b). In these two tungsten complexes 2a, b as well as in the analogous chromium complex mer-(BF4)(CO)3[P(CH3)3]CrCCH3 (4) the BF4 ligand is displaced easily by nucleophilic reagents. With thiocyanate, cyanide, and triphenylphosphine the corresponding neutral trans-isothiocyanato (6a, b) and trans-cyano complexes (7) as well as the cationic trans-(organylcarbyne)(triphenylphosphine)metal complexes (3, 5) are obtained similarly at low temperatures.
